When I open the TABCTL32.OCX file with regsvr32, i got the Following error:

"C:/..blah blah../TABCTL32.OCX" was loaded but the call to DllregisterServer Failed with error code 00x8002801c. for more information on this problem..blah blah blah.

I googled for an our on this and havent found a solution. Also, just to be clear, id like to know the exact registry location for all the other files please. My OS is Windows 8 so i know that could cause a probelm but all my system folders are there. I do have a System32 file in windows, so it shouldnt be a problem. But i also have a file called SysWOW64 witch i assume is my 64bit OS system registry. The program wont run still so when anyone can get back to me on this id be a happy gamer Wink

***UPDATED***
Problem solved

For me, I had to run command promtp as Admin, then type the following command exactly like this: regsvr32 tabctl32.ocx
then the file finally registered. I ended up having to do the exact same thing with the msstdfmt.dll file as well. So there you go Biggrin

Hi, just registered to say that I was having the same problem trying to get the Final Fantasy V (SNES) editor to work. In addition to running a command prompt (in my case PowerShell) as admin by using Win+X, I had to type regsvr32 c:\windows\SysWOW64\comdlg32.ocx and not regsvr32 %Systemroot%\SysWOW64\comdlg32.ocx as was directed by the developer's website.

I then repeated the process for each of the Visual Basic files required for the program to run. Hope this helps someone.

(I'm using Windows 10)
